Build a strong and efficient IoT solution at industrial and enterprise level by mastering industrial IoT using Microsoft Azure. This book focuses on the development of the industrial Internet of Things (IIoT) paradigm, discussing various architectures, as well as providing nine case studies employing IoT in common industrial domains including medical, supply chain, finance, and smart homes. The book starts by giving you an overview of the basic concepts of IoT, after which you will go through the various offerings of the Microsoft Azure IoT platform and its services. Next, you will get hands-on experience of IoT applications in various industries to give you a better picture of industrial solutions and how you should take your industry forward. As you progress through the chapters, you will learn real-time applications in IoT in agriculture, supply chain, financial services, retail, and transportation. Towards the end, you will gain knowledge to identify andanalyze IoT security and privacy risks along with a detailed sample project. The book fills an important gap in the learning of IoT and its practical use case in your industry. Therefore, this is a practical guide that helps you discover the technologies and use cases for IIoT. By the end of this book, you will be able to build industrial IoT solution in Microsoft Azure with sensors, stream analytics, and serverless technologies. What You Will LearnProvision, configure, and connect devices with Microsoft Azure IoT hub Stream analytics using structural data and non-structural data such as images Use stream analytics, serverless technology, and IoT SaaS offeringsWork with common sensors and IoT devicesWho This Book Is ForIoT architects, developers, and stakeholders working with the industrial Internet of Things.

Author Biography
Nirnay Bansal is certified solution architect and working at Microsoft Corp, Redmond, WA since 2015. He graduated in computer science from BITS, Pilani and MBA from Louisiana State University (S). He has been working for over 15 years on large and complex IT projects. He is a technical specialist in providing architecture, development, and consultancy, using Microsoft technologies including Microsoft Azure. Among his past clients are Frontier communication, Fidelity, PricewaterHouseCoopers and Dell.Nirnay is one of the well-known experts when it comes to designing cloud-based solution and data scenarios. Additionally, he participates in public events as speaker for Code Camps. Along with various Microsoft certifications, he is a Microsoft Certified Trainer (MCT) and a certified Solution Architect from IASA. Table of Contents
Chapter 1: Industry 4.0 Movement.- Chapter 2: Basic IoT Concepts.- Chapter 3: Microsoft Azure IoT Platform.- Chapter 4: Streaming IoT data to Microsoft Azure .- Chapter 5: IoT Applications in Manufacturing.- Chapter 6: IoT Applications in Agriculture.- Chapter 7: IoT Applications in Energy.- Chapter 8: IoT Applications in Smart Homes.- Chapter 9: IoT Applications in the Supply Chain.- Chapter 10: IoT Applications in Financial Services.- Chapter 11: IoT Applications in Healthcare.- Chapter 12: IoT Applications in Retail.- Chapter 13: IoT Applications in Transportation – Chapter 14: Risk.
